He Wants Me Back, but I'm Mrs. CEO Now

After two years of marriage to billionaire Christopher Hayes, Sienna Grant is confronted by her ex-boyfriend, Benjamin Clarke. He arrives at her estate with lavish gifts, claiming he only fathered a child with his sister-in-law to preserve his late brother's bloodline. Now that his 'duty' is done, he expects Sienna to marry him. However, Sienna has already moved on; she is now a mother to the Hayes Group heir and has no interest in Benjamin's arrogant demands or his lack of respect for her new life.

Chapter 1

I've been married to billionaire CEO Christopher Hayes for two years, and only now does my ex, Benjamin Clarke, decide to propose.

The rumble of engines echoes as a fleet of black trucks lines up neatly outside my private estate. The drivers unload box after box of gifts—luxury watches, fine jewelry, couture gowns, and even a grand piano.

Standing proudly among the shower of rose petals, he announces, "Sienna, I told you—the only reason I had a child with my sister-in-law was because my older brother died in an accident, and she wanted to keep our family's bloodline alive.

"The baby just turned a month old. I've fulfilled my promise to her, and now I've come to marry you!"

I lounge in the heated pool, having just finished my postpartum recovery exercises, and I can't even be bothered to look at him.

He knits his brows, and his tone turns patronizing. "I know you're upset, but you're the heiress of the Grant family; you have everything you could ever want! Why can't you show a little compassion for a widow who just lost her husband?

"I know it was selfish of me to make you wait for two years, but I'm back now! Our wedding will be held in three days. I can tell you still care about me. If not, why would you greet me in such a revealing bikini?"

His overconfidence makes me chuckle. "Guards, get him out of here! I'm trying to swim here."

What a joke. I've just welcomed the heir of Hayes Group into the world, and Christopher has been insisting that I take our baby home to visit my parents. Yet, somehow, I end up running into this idiot.

Benjamin Clarke leaned against the door of his limited-edition Aston Martin like he owned the whole street. He took off his sunglasses, revealing sharp brows, deep-set eyes, and a mocking little smile.

"I get it," he drawled. "You're playing hard to get. You've got your pride, and I've got the patience to wait it out. I know you lash out at anyone who gets too close, but you'd never let yourself lose.

"Unlike you, Olivia's gentle and kind. Even when someone picks on her, she just cries in secret. She needs someone to protect her." His tone dripped with a pretentious tenderness that made my stomach churn.

"Sienna, even if I marry you, that doesn't mean you can use my love as an excuse to pick on her. Olivia will always hold the same place in my heart as you."

Two years ago, those words would have crushed me. Yet, I found them unbearably dull now.

"Benjamin, what makes you think I've been waiting for you all this time?" I asked calmly.

His expression stiffened.

"Did it ever occur to you that I might already belong to someone else?"

Benjamin stared at me for a second before bursting out in laughter, as if I'd just cracked the world's funniest joke. "As if that would happen! We've been engaged since we were kids. The whole city knows you're mine. Who'd dare touch my woman?"

He closed in on me and caressed my cheek affectionately, invading my personal space. "Let's be honest, you're gorgeous, but your temper's awful. Who else could ever put up with you besides me?"

"This is the real Benjamin—a narcissistic wolf in sheep's clothing," I sneered inwardly.

"Sienna, I may have been traveling with Olivia, but I still keep up with the business world," he continued. "Your family's business has been going downhill over the past two years. No one wants to marry you now.

"Plus, you're already 25. What are you going to do if you don't marry me? Save yourself for the grave?"

I plastered a smile on my face. In his eyes, I was still that useless little girl.

We'd grown up together and were childhood sweethearts for as long as I could remember.

At our college graduation, he'd proposed to me in public, turning our love story into a fairytale everyone envied. However, the night before our wedding, he'd gone behind my back and gotten his late brother's widow pregnant.

When I'd confronted him, he hadn't even tried to deny it. In fact, he'd said self-righteously, "My brother's gone, and Olivia's heartbroken; she wants a child to remember him by. Give me two years, Sienna. Once the baby's born, I'll marry you!"

My heart had gone cold when I heard that. Right then and there, I had thrown my engagement ring into the trash and blocked him on every social platform.

That same year, Hayes Group had hosted a grand business gala where the nation's elites drank champagne and made deals. I'd been cornered by two socialites who mocked me in public for losing my fiance, Benjamin, to his sister-in-law.

That was when Christopher Hayes, heir to Hayes Group, had walked into my life. He had placed a firm hand on my lower back and swept his sharp gaze across the hall. "Sienna's my fiancee, and anyone who disrespects her disrespects me!"

No one had dared to look me in the eye, let alone insult me again.

Then, he'd led me to the empty terrace and asked me to give him a chance to make his lie a reality. I'd said yes.

Benjamin's voice snapped me back to reality. "In any case, even though you've blocked me for two years, I know you were just mad at me."

He pointed at the white cat that was rubbing its head against my leg. "I bought that for you the year we got engaged. If you really wanted to cut ties with me, you'd have gotten rid of it ages ago. But you didn't; you've taken good care of it.

"I know you're still in love with me, Sienna. You've been waiting for me all this time."

I'd almost laughed at how confident he looked. I had barely been home since I married Christopher two years ago. My parents had been taking care of that cat.

Besides, it was such a sweet creature. How could I possibly take out my anger over a failed relationship on an innocent life?

He mistook my silence for surrender and smirked. "Don't worry. Three days from now, I'll throw you the grandest wedding this city has ever seen!"

I couldn't be bothered to waste my breath on him. I grabbed the garden hose by the pool, turned the nozzle, and sprayed him full force. "Get out of my face, Benjamin!"

He was drenched from head to toe. His hair clung to his forehead, and his bespoke suit was ruined, yet he was still all smiles. "That's my girl. You're still as fiery as you were two years ago. I know you still have feelings for me!"

He spread his arms, as if he was soaking in the moment. "I promise I'll never betray you, Sienna. You and Olivia are the two most important women in my life!"
